MS-60 Pyranometer

The MS-60 is a first class pyranometer (Class B Pyranometer) meeting ISO 9060:2018 Approvals. It is available with a variety of output options which include: MS-60 (analog voltage), MS-60A (4-20mA) or MS-60M (RS485) or the standard MS-60 (mV output). 

All sensors provide a "spectrally flat" response across 285 - 3000 nm, an irradiance range of 0-2000 W/m2 and are IP67 rated.

The MS-60 series features a double dome construction that provides lower offsets and cosine errors. All sensors come with a 2 year calibration interval and can be used with an optional MV-01 ventilator and heater. The MS-60 are available with cables ranging from 10 m to 50 m lengths.

Now available with Smart Sensing Technology, the new MS-60S preserves the high accuracy of the sensor while complying with the various output standards used in the industry. The new Smart signal transducer allows selecting from 4 types of output in one unit (MODBUS 485 RTU, SDI-12, 4-20mA, configurable 0-10mA / 0-1V with external optional 100Ω precision shunt resistor). The new electronics ensure a great benefit for system integrators who work with various industrial interface standards.

  • ISO 9060:2018 Class B (First class)
  • Sub-category "Spectrally flat"
  • ISO 17025 certified calibration
  • 5 year warranty and recommended recalibration
  • Smart interface: (MODBUS 485 RTU, SDI-12, 4-20mA, configurable 0-10mA / 0-1V with external optional 100Ω precision shunt resistor)
  • Diagnostic functions (relative humidity, temperature, tilt angle)
  • On-board Data processing

Specifications MS-60
ISO 9060:2018 Class B
ISO 9060:1990 (First Class)
Sub-category "Spectrally flat" Compliant
Sub-category "Fast response" Not compliant
Output Analog (mV)
Response time 95% < 18 Sec.
Zero off-set a) 200W/m² +/- 5 W/m²
Zero off-set b) 5K/hr +/- 2 W/m²
Complete zero off-set c) +/- 7 W/m²
Non-stability change/1 year +/- 1.5 %
Non-linearity at 1000W/m² +/- 1 %
Directional response at 1000W/m² +/- 18 W/m²
Spectral error +/- 0.2 %
Temperature response -10°C to 40°C < 3 %
Temperature response -20°C to 50°C < 4 %
Tilt response at 1000W/m² +/- 1 %
Sensitivity Approx. 10 µV/W/m²
Impedance 100 Ω
Operating temperature range -40 - 80 °C
Irradiance range 0 - 2000 W/m²
Wavelength range 285 - 3000 nm
Ingress protection IP 67
Cable length 10 m
